Marketing research is a key prerequisite to successful decision making; it consists of a set of techniques and principles for systematically collecting, recording, analyzing, and interpreting data that can aid decision makers involved in marketing goods, services or ideas. When marketing managers attempt to develop their strategies, marketing research can provide valuable information that will help them make segmentation, positioning, product, place, price, and promotion decisions. Firms invest millions of dollars in marketing research every year. Canada"s market research industry is valued at just under a half-billion dollars. Marketers find research valuable as it helps reduce some of the uncertainty under which they currently operate. Successful managers known when research might help their decision-making and then take appropriate steps to acquire the information they need. Marketing research provides a crucial link between firms and their environments, which enables firms to be customer oriented because they build their strategies by using customer input and continual feedback.
